Where to Buy Cheap Tools?
Discovering cost effective tools does not have to be an overwhelming job. Here are numerous locations to explore:
1. Regional Hardware Stores
Local hardware stores typically have sales and discounts on different tools. Additionally, they typically have clearance sections that provide outstanding deals.
2. Thrift Shops and Flea Markets
Someone's disposed of tool might be another's treasure. Thrift stores and flea markets can be a goldmine for inexpensive tools. Always examine items thoroughly to guarantee they remain in working condition.
3. Online Marketplaces
Websites like eBay, Craigslist, and Facebook Marketplace often have listings for both new and pre-owned tools at lower prices. Simply guarantee you're buying from credible sellers and look for scores.
4. Tool Rental Shops
Leasing tools for specific jobs can assist save money. Tool rental stores provide access to higher-quality equipment without the high cost of purchase.
5. Huge Box Retailers
Stores like Home Depot, Lowe's, and Walmart frequently run promos and discount rates on tools. Watch on seasonal sales, clearance items, and commitment programs.

When acquiring low-cost tools, keep the following pointers in mind to ensure you get the most worth for your cash:
1. Research and Read Reviews
Before purchasing any tool, conduct thorough research. Sites like Amazon and specialized tool evaluation sites can supply insights into item efficiency and durability.
2. Look for Warranty
Even inexpensive tools can in some cases feature a service warranty. A warranty can provide comfort, guaranteeing that if the tool fails, you can get a replacement or repair work.
3. Buy Cheap Power Tools Online Sets When Possible
Purchasing tools in sets can typically lower costs. For example, a set of screwdrivers or wrenches will generally cost less than buying each piece separately.
4. Concentrate On Essential Tools
Consider what tools you really require and focus on those. Buying important tools will set you up for success without breaking the bank. Some essential tools include:

When purchasing utilized tools, check them thoroughly. Search for indications of wear, rust, or any damage that may impact performance.
